Messina, Italy - March 2019 - On 31 March, the work sessions of the III meeting of the 30th Provincial Chapter of the Salesians of Sicily and Tunisia (ISI) came to an end. Fr Giuseppe Ruta, ISI Provincial, in the closing speech thanked the Lord for the century-old presence of the Salesians in Sicily. In fact, Don Bosco opened a Salesian house aimed at the salvation of Sicilian youth in 1879. Today, as then, 140 years later, the Salesian spirit - which the spiritual sons of the Saint of Turin embody - is still very much present.

Rome, Italy - 85 years ago, on a day like today, 1 April 1934, Don Bosco was declared a saint by Pope Pius XI. “The infallible successor of St. Peter, by solemnly whispering the words, then pronounced this formula - writes Fr Eugenio Ceria - we decree and define that Blessed Giovanni Bosco is a saint and we register him in the number of saints.” Fr. Pietro Ricaldone, Rector Major, writes in a message: “Vatican City, 1st April, at a quarter past ten. Alleluia! The Vicar of Christ has just proclaimed Don Bosco a saint. May he bless Turin, Italy and the world.”

Messina, Italy - March 2019 - On March 17, the annual Provincial Assembly of the Association of Salesian Cooperators (ASC) of Sicily was held in the Salesian house "San Matteo", in the Giostra district of Messina. About 300 members gathered to discuss and form themselves on the theme "Courage in the beauty of the #lostuporediunsorriso, or the stupor or marvel of a smile" mission. After the initial prayer, led by Sr. Valeria Marotta, FMA, Fr Paolo Caltabiano, SDB, spoke, summoning the ASC members to know how to read the times having Intelligence, Fantasy or Imagination and a sense of Risk-taking. Then, in a packed theater, the performance of Marco Rodari, aka "Clown the Pimpa", a clown with a special mission, was held as his audience are the children of the territories battered by war such as in Syria, Iraq and the Strip of Gaza. Then the assembly was divided into 4 thematic groups to discuss the key words of the day: Courage, Beauty, Mission, Amazement.

RMG – Don Bosco: “The Fascinating Saint”
(ANS - Rome) - Don Bosco is perhaps the most amazing and fascinating saint, history has ever produced. The humble work which he began for the welfare of his poor and abandoned boys in Italy has produced astonishing results, and today there are nearly 14000 Salesians working in 138 countries, and there are more than 200,000 members belonging to the 32 groups of the worldwide Salesian Family sharing the charism of Don Bosco and reaching out to the needy young people.
